Neutrino Mass, Leptogenesis, and Dark Matter from The Dark Sector with $U(1)_{D}$
Published 29 Sep 2017 in hep-ph | (1710.00691v3)
Abstract: I suggest a new extension of the SM by introducing a dark sector which has several new particles and a local $U(1)_{D}$ symmetry. The dark particles bring about the new and interesting physics beyond the SM. The model can generate the tiny neutrino mass by a hybrid see-saw mechanism, achieve the leptogenesis at the TeV scale, and account for the cold dark matter. All of the three things collectively arise from the dark sector. In particular, it is very feasible to test the model predictions and probe the dark sector in near future experiments.
